Beginning of a new innings in Darjeeling, thanks to the initiatives of WB CM

Thanks to the initiatives taken by the Chief Minister and the State administration, peace has finally been restored in Darjeeling. Apart from the development initiatives by the State Government in the Hills, the people will also be involved in the cultural activities of the rest of Bengal. Towards that end, the CM has decided to hold celebrations of the birth anniversary of Netaji Subhas Chandra Bose in Darjeeling on 23 January, 2014. The Chief Minister will be present at Darjeeling on the occasion.
On 26 December, 2013 Bimal Gurung took oath of office as the new GTA Chief, in the presence of the Chief Minister at Raj Bhavan. On the occasion, the Chief Minister said that this event marked the beginning of a new innings in Darjeeling. She congratulated the new GTA Head and said that, `West Bengal is on its path of development and Darjeeling is on its path of peace. We well walk together. We will do much more work. Our aim is to walk on the roads of more development`.
The Chief Minister during her upcoming visit to North Bengal will inaugurate the North Bengal Secretariat on January 20, 2014.
She will inaugurate the renovated `Roy Villa`, the house where Sister Nivedita spent her last days, on January 22.
On 23rd January, the programme organized by the State Government will celebrate the birth anniversary of Netaji Subhas Chandra Bose in Darjeeling. Artists from all over the state will assemble in the cultural milieau.
